Who Rings Rome's Church Bells? Not Always a Bell Ringer
A few years ago, I recorded a podcast episode about something many of us notice in Italy but rarely stop to think about - the sound of church bells drifting across the city. I found myself wondering: is there really someone up there in the bell tower pulling the ropes, or is it all automated now?
Around that time, my husband showed me a newspaper article about a Roman bell ringer whose fascination with bells began when he was still a toddler in a stroller. His mother would take him around Rome to hear different bells ringing at different hours because he loved them so much. That early curiosity stayed with him, and as an adult he became a bell ringer himself. I knew immediately I wanted to speak with him.
The episode that followed turned into a wonderful exploration of bell ringing traditions in Italy. I learned about different regional styles, including the distinctive system used in Verona, and even how Italian approaches compare with English bell ringing. It opened up a whole hidden world behind a sound we hear so often without realizing what's involved.
I'm re-releasing this episode now because it feels especially appropriate at this moment. As Holy Week approaches, Rome fills with the sound of bells. Whether you're here in the city or simply remembering visits past - or planning a future trip - this episode will change the way you listen. Sometimes there's a person high in the bell tower guiding those sounds. Sometimes there isn't. Either way, there's a story behind every bell you hear.
This has always been one of my favorite episodes of the Flavor of Italy podcast, and I hope you enjoy it as much as I do.
And if you're in Rome during this season of ringing bells, listen closely - now you'll know what may be happening high above you.
